According to Stratistics MRC, the Global Patient Engagement Solutions Market is accounted for $17.3 billion in 2022 and is expected to reach $34.1 billion by 2028 growing at a CAGR of 12.0% during the forecast period. Patient engagement solutions are those that allow patients to communicate with medical practitioners via online portals, resulting in improved communication channels. Technologically advanced patient point of care, such as self-assistance, improved diagnosis, better decision making, healthcare delivery quality, and data management, are fuelling market expansion.

Restraint
Large investments are required in healthcare infrastructure
Moving or merging healthcare infrastructure technologies with patient engagement solutions would provide numerous cost issues for these organisations. Payers have previously made significant investments in infrastructure and proprietary systems. It will also necessitate improvements to their current systems, which are designed to manage only their current needs. Furthermore, the transition to cloud-based patient interaction tools will necessitate a change in present IT architecture, particularly in hospitals that already function as hubs for many clinicians, labs, and pharmacists. As a result, finding the resources to enable large-scale interoperability and interconnection may impede such healthcare organisations' shift to cloud-based patient engagement systems which hampers the growth of the market.

Threat
Healthcare IT system deployment costs are high.
Software solutions for healthcare IT systems are expensive. These systems maintenance and software upgrade costs may exceed the cost of the software. Support and maintenance services, as well as software upgrades, are recurrent expenses that account for over 30% of total cost of ownership. The healthcare industry's lack of internal skilled IT workers mandates training for end users to boost the efficiency and results of various healthcares IT solutions, consequently increasing the cost of ownership of the systems. Evaluating information systems in healthcare can also be difficult due to the intangible organisational impact and benefits of IT systems in healthcare.
Covid-19 Impact
The COVID-19 epidemic has sparked new developments in patient monitoring and cloud computing. In April 2020, for example, GE Healthcare introduced a novel cloud-based remote-monitoring technology designed to help doctors care for ventilated COVID-19 patients. The expanding global smartphone user base has accelerated the adoption of mHealth across the sector, both from providers and consumers. Healthcare apps are on the rise, and they are simple to install on cellphones. These apps can be linked to wearable devices and assist users in overall health management, which has increased patients' reliance on mHealth apps. As a result, the COVID-19 pandemic is expected to play a significant role in digital transformation.
